Because the state of affairs within the Center East has spiralled this week, Russia’s warfare in Ukraine rages on — nonetheless bankrolled partially by European funds for fossil fuels. Slicing off that stream of money is proving a fearsomely tough process, as I clarify in as we speak’s publication.Contained in the EU’s power coverage debateTo many in Europe, the case for a speedy transfer away from reliance on Russian gasoline appears unarguable. Because the EU seeks to bolster Ukraine’s defence in opposition to Moscow’s invasion, how can it maintain channelling large sums in direction of Vladimir Putin’s warfare machine?That argument is prevailing in Brussels, the place officers are urgent forward with a plan to halt all Russian fossil gas imports from the beginning of 2028. The EU’s power technique entails an enormous improve in gasoline imports from different suppliers, in addition to an acceleration within the shift to inexperienced power. However the plan doesn’t have unanimous consensus among the many 27 EU member states — with the strongest dissent coming from Viktor Orbán’s Hungarian authorities. That’s prompted the European Fee to develop a plan to ban Russian gasoline contracts utilizing commerce regulation, with a view to sidestep a possible Hungarian veto, the FT reported this week.Orbán’s critics have accused him of an unjustifiable stage of help for the Russian regime — partly pushed, they recommend, by a sure affinity with Putin’s authoritarian governance model. Orbán’s personal weakening of civil liberties and the rule of regulation in Hungary have led to the freezing of billions of euros in EU monetary help.I heard Budapest’s response to this criticism set out in blistering vogue this week by Péter Szijjártó, Hungarian overseas affairs and commerce minister. Szijjártó is one in every of Russia’s most attentive remaining mates, having made 13 journeys there for the reason that invasion of Ukraine.However he insisted that the continued heat stance in direction of Moscow was pushed by pragmatism about Hungary’s power safety fairly than by ideology.Critics who accuse his authorities of being “Russian spies, puppets of Moscow . . . know nothing in regards to the regional bodily and infrastructural realities”, Szijjártó instructed the FT’s Marton Dunai on the FT-Kathimerini Power Transition Summit in Athens.Not like Germany or France, which have invested closely in infrastructure for importing liquefied pure gasoline, “we’re a landlocked nation, depending on our neighbours and their neighbours”, Szijjártó famous.This, he mentioned, was the important thing cause why Hungary continues to import the overwhelming majority of its oil and gasoline from Russia. The European Fee says that purchases from Russia have fallen from 45 per cent of EU gasoline imports in 2021 to 19 per cent final 12 months, whereas simply 3 per cent of EU oil imports got here from Russia in 2024. However Hungary stays closely reliant on Russian hydrocarbons, and is now the EU’s largest importer of Russian gasoline, which it receives primarily by way of the TurkStream pipeline that passes by way of Turkey and Bulgaria.Underneath Brussels’s REPowerEU plan to section out Russian power imports — introduced three months after Russia’s February 2022 invasion of Ukraine— Hungary would require an enormous improve of its gasoline interconnection infrastructure with neighbouring nations. Szijjártó accused the European Fee of refusing to offer help for such funding, partially on account of its broader technique of shifting away from fossil fuels.An effort by south-east European nations to safe EU monetary help for an enlargement of gasoline pipeline infrastructure was “rejected by Brussels, saying that gasoline just isn’t going to be a part of the power combine in 10 years . . . it’s not stylish, not attractive anymore to make use of gasoline”, Szijjártó mentioned.Among the many 27 EU member states, Hungary is an outlier within the continued heat of its relations with Moscow. So too in its erosion of democratic rules — not less than within the eyes of fellow EU members, as proven by the extraordinary monetary stress they’ve utilized. Hungary’s many critics will view its resistance to the REPowerEU plan as one other effort to carry a flagship technique hostage with a view to safe concessions.However in its discomfort with EU power coverage, Budapest is way from alone. Fellow landlocked nation Slovakia has additionally pushed again in opposition to the hassle to section out Russian gasoline. Austria, one other coast-free nation, urged this week that the EU should be open to resuming Russian power imports upon the tip of the Ukraine warfare.At this week’s convention in Athens, senior authorities and company figures from a number of south-east European nations — most of which have supported the tip to Russian gasoline imports — voiced unhappiness with the hole between the costly power costs of their area and the cheaper charges in northern and western Europe.“We’re deprived” by the failure to construct a totally built-in EU power system, mentioned Greek Prime Minister Kyriakos Mitsotakis. “We’re doing our justifiable share when it comes to transferring in direction of the [energy strategy] objectives. Why ought to we pay a lot larger costs in a market that not less than ought to purpose in direction of worth parity?”That regional worth hole stems partially from the EU’s slowness to implement market reforms and interconnection infrastructure to facilitate cross-border power gross sales. It’s additionally partially as a result of north-western nations have rolled out low-cost renewables at higher scale than their south-eastern friends, and have been more practical in creating bodily and market connections amongst themselves.The controversy over accountability for these underlying points will rumble on, as will the arguments about Orbán’s actions at residence and overseas. However nonetheless legitimate the moral and safety grounds for the EU’s shift away from Russian power, it’ll undeniably be far tougher and disruptive for some member states than for others.
